Breakfast Charcuterie Board


  • Author: Sally Thompson
  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: 4-6 servings 1x

Description

This Breakfast Charcuterie Board is the perfect way to enjoy a leisurely breakfast or brunch with friends and family. A mix of sweet and savory components, it includes fresh fruits, cheeses, cured meats, breads, boiled eggs, and sweet spreads. It’s easy to customize and visually impressive, making it a delightful addition to any morning meal.


Ingredients

Scale

4 Croissants

1 Baguette

3 oz Cheddar cheese

3 oz Brie cheese

3 oz Goat cheese

6 slices Prosciutto

6 slices Salami

6 slices Ham

4 Boiled eggs

1 cup Fresh berries (strawberries, raspberries, blackberries)

1 cup Grapes

2 tbsp Jam (your choice of flavor)

2 tbsp Honey

1 cup Greek yogurt

1 cup Pickles or Olives


Instructions

1. Slice the croissants and baguette into bite-sized pieces and arrange them on a large platter.

2. Place the cheeses (cheddar, brie, and goat cheese) around the breads. Leave whole or slice the cheese, depending on your preference.

3. Roll or fold the cured meats (prosciutto, salami, ham) and arrange them near the cheeses.

4. Add the fresh berries and grapes in sections around the board for easy access.

5. Halve the boiled eggs and place them on the board, arranging them neatly.

6. Add small bowls of jam and honey for spreading. Place them near the breads and cheeses.

7. Add Greek yogurt in a small bowl and place it in a convenient spot on the board.

8. Include pickles or olives for a savory balance, placing them in small dishes or scattered across the board.
